Product details

The telescopes feature fully coated glass lenses, a specially developed azimuth mount with a unique asymmetrical design, a sturdy steel tripod with an integrated foldable accessory tray, a built-in universal smartphone adapter for photography, an integrated LED flashlight, a large red dot finder, and a focuser with a micrometer for easier focus retrieval, all while providing an upright image. The Inspire models are incredibly easy to set up, even simpler than other models in this class: simply unfold the tripod legs, tighten the accessory tray's locking screw, and attach the telescope to the mount using the dovetail quick-release. Just remove the protective caps and insert the eyepiece - and you're ready to observe. The dust cover has a built-in smartphone holder. Simply attach your smartphone to the cover so that the camera looks through the hole and secure it with two rubber bands. On the inside of the cover, there is an adapter with two clamping screws to attach the cover to the eyepiece. Et voilà. You can now easily photograph through your telescope. The mount also houses a red LED flashlight. Turn it on, and the accessory tray is softly illuminated in red, without disturbing your dark adaptation. The flashlight can also be easily removed, allowing you to have light wherever you need it. The micrometer scale on the focuser marks the position of the eyepiece drawtube, enabling you to quickly reproduce specific focus settings, such as for infinity or a nearby bird's nest.
